This premium wooden play food set by Airlab features 7 colorful fruits crafted from renewable rubber wood and painted with safe water-based dyes. Designed for toddlers 3+, the pieces connect with nylon buckles that produce a realistic cutting sound, enhancing sensory play. The set includes a wooden knife and storage box, promoting fine motor skills, hand-eye coordination, and screen-free imaginative fun. Fun to do for a toddler
My 1 year old loves this set, super fun. The quality is good, all wood. Comes with a tray for storage. Good for learning and imagination. It is a little smaller than I thought it would be. But nice toy overall.

Super cute toy
My grandbaby loved "cutting" her fruit! This set is well made, and really helps refine small motor skills. The kiwi looks a little less like a kiwi and more like a large green pill, but she didn't care. The velcro does loosen up a little bit after use, which will make it easier to cut.

Wooden fruit in crate
Arrived on time, packaged in a box that is nice for gift giving. Wooden fruit were smooth and well painted with small hook n loop centers where the children cut. Lovely set for toddler fingers. The wooden “knife” easily cuts each piece of wooden fruit, but not little fingers. It comes with a cute little wooden crate. Look at size, these are not large. Durable toy. Good quality.
